Roma coach Paulo Fonseca could remain in Serie A and is reportedly open for a move to Fiorentina.

Tuttomercatoweb reports the Portuguese coach, who will be replaced by Jose Mourinho ahead of 2021-22, has shown his willingness to move to Firenze once his stint in the capital is over.

The report reveals Gennaro Gattuso rejected Rocco Commisso’s proposal and the hunt for a new coach continues, as Beppe Iachini’s time at the Viola will certainly end after the campaign.

Fonseca will have to take a salary cut at Fiorentina, but he is reportedly tempted to move to Florence and would love to relaunch his career at the Artemio Franchi after some difficult years in Rome.

The former Sporting Braga and Shakhtar Donetsk coach has spent the last two seasons with the Giallorossi and helped the team reach the semi-finals of the Europa League this term.
